Role Overview
This role puts you on the front line of growth for last expense cover, a funeral-related insurance product sold to individuals and institutions around Nairobi. Most of your week is spent in the field — finding families and organisations who need protection, explaining how the cover works, and guiding buyers all the way through to an issued policy. The work matters because each closed sale means a household that won't be pushed into debt when a funeral arrives.
Key Responsibilities
- Generate new business through workplace presentations, referrals, door-to-door visits, and community activations, keeping a steady flow of qualified prospects in your book.
- Explain last expense cover in plain language — premium amounts, payout tiers, and how often payments are made — so buyers understand exactly what their family would receive.
- Move prospects from first conversation to signed application, handling objections and negotiating within company guidelines.
- Reach agreed monthly sales and revenue targets, and keep track of your own performance against quota.
- Stay in contact with existing policyholders, respond to questions about their cover and documents, and encourage on-time premium payments and renewals.
- Help each client choose the package that fits their household size and budget rather than pushing a single standard policy.
- Check application forms and supporting documents before passing them to processing, catching errors that would delay or void cover.
- Record daily field activity — visits, calls, leads, and closed deals — and send sales reports and market feedback to the Sales Manager.
